出版時(shí)間:2009-1 出版社:電子工業(yè)出版社 作者:張銀鶴,唐有明,王俊偉 編著 頁(yè)數(shù):389
Tag標(biāo)簽:無(wú)
前言
JSP (Java Server Pages)是Sun公司以Java語(yǔ)言為腳本語(yǔ)言開(kāi)發(fā)出來(lái)的一種動(dòng)態(tài)網(wǎng)頁(yè)制作技術(shù),主要完成網(wǎng)頁(yè)中服務(wù)器的動(dòng)態(tài)部分的編寫(xiě)。該技術(shù)是在Servlet技術(shù)基礎(chǔ)上形成的,并繼承了Java語(yǔ)言的多種優(yōu)勢(shì),如安全性、支持多線程、平臺(tái)無(wú)關(guān)性等;與其他動(dòng)態(tài)網(wǎng)頁(yè)技術(shù)(如ASP、PHP等)相比較,具有運(yùn)行速度快,安全性高等特點(diǎn)?! jax (Asynchronous JavaScript and XML)是多種技術(shù)的綜合,它使用HTML和CSS標(biāo)準(zhǔn)化呈現(xiàn),使用DOM實(shí)現(xiàn)動(dòng)態(tài)顯示和交互,使用XML和XST進(jìn)行數(shù)據(jù)交換與處理,使用XMLHupRequest對(duì)象進(jìn)行異步數(shù)據(jù)讀取,使用JavaScript綁定和處理所有數(shù)據(jù)。更重要的是,它打破了使用頁(yè)面重載的慣例技術(shù),可以說(shuō),Ajax已成為Web開(kāi)發(fā)的重要武器!Ajax技術(shù)是基于被各大瀏覽器和平臺(tái)都支持的公開(kāi)標(biāo)準(zhǔn)的技術(shù)。組成Ajax技術(shù)的大多數(shù)技術(shù)都經(jīng)過(guò)了很多年的實(shí)踐考驗(yàn),而不是那些熱點(diǎn)的、最新的和未經(jīng)考驗(yàn)的技術(shù)。
內(nèi)容概要
本書(shū)以實(shí)例的方式介紹JSP技術(shù)和AjaX技術(shù),這兩種技術(shù)是目前最為流行的服務(wù)器端和客戶(hù)端技術(shù)。本書(shū)主要內(nèi)容包括JSP基礎(chǔ)實(shí)例、JSP數(shù)據(jù)庫(kù)實(shí)例、JavaBean技術(shù)、Servlet技術(shù)、Ajax基本技術(shù)、Ajax高級(jí)技術(shù)、Ajax數(shù)據(jù)庫(kù)操作、Ajax時(shí)尚技術(shù)、Ajax常用框架和實(shí)現(xiàn)OA系統(tǒng)。本書(shū)實(shí)例來(lái)源于作者多年工作實(shí)踐,基本囊括了當(dāng)今流行的各種典型實(shí)例,講解由淺入深、環(huán)環(huán)相扣,分析細(xì)致,實(shí)用性強(qiáng)。 本書(shū)是初學(xué)者的入門(mén)經(jīng)典書(shū)籍,是Ajax和JSP技術(shù)程序員的必備工具書(shū)。
書(shū)籍目錄
第1章 JSP基礎(chǔ)實(shí)例 實(shí)例1 JSP測(cè)試頁(yè)面 實(shí)例2 登錄界面制作 實(shí)例3 request對(duì)象獲取客戶(hù)端參數(shù) 實(shí)例4 列表框在頁(yè)面交互中的應(yīng)用 實(shí)例5 JSP頁(yè)面顯示課程表 實(shí)例6 獲取Cookie對(duì)象保存頁(yè)面信息 實(shí)例7 使用session對(duì)象的簡(jiǎn)易購(gòu)物車(chē) 實(shí)例8 application對(duì)象實(shí)現(xiàn)網(wǎng)站計(jì)數(shù)器 實(shí)例9 使用JSP讀取TXT格式文件 實(shí)例10 使用JSP讀取HTML格式文件第2章 JSP與數(shù)據(jù)庫(kù) 實(shí)例11 使用JSP連接數(shù)據(jù)庫(kù)大全 實(shí)例12 實(shí)現(xiàn)通訊錄 實(shí)例13 使用JDBC實(shí)現(xiàn)插入1000條記錄 實(shí)例14 使甩JDBC實(shí)現(xiàn)數(shù)據(jù)庫(kù)存儲(chǔ)過(guò)程 實(shí)例15 使甩JDBC創(chuàng)建數(shù)據(jù)庫(kù)、表和字段 實(shí)例16 分頁(yè)顯示信息 實(shí)例17 JDBC實(shí)現(xiàn)數(shù)據(jù)庫(kù)事務(wù)操作 實(shí)例18 簡(jiǎn)單新聞發(fā)布系統(tǒng) 實(shí)例19實(shí)現(xiàn)數(shù)據(jù)庫(kù)連接池第3章 JSP與JavaBean 實(shí)例20 實(shí)現(xiàn)數(shù)據(jù)庫(kù)添加、更新和刪除 實(shí)例21 實(shí)現(xiàn)文件上傳與下載 實(shí)例22 實(shí)現(xiàn)數(shù)據(jù)加密與解密 實(shí)例23 實(shí)現(xiàn)分頁(yè)功能 實(shí)例24 實(shí)現(xiàn)文件過(guò)濾 實(shí)例25 實(shí)現(xiàn)記錄登錄信息 實(shí)例26 實(shí)現(xiàn)計(jì)數(shù)器功能 實(shí)例27 實(shí)現(xiàn)購(gòu)物車(chē)功能 實(shí)例28 實(shí)現(xiàn)簡(jiǎn)單計(jì)算器 實(shí)例29 實(shí)現(xiàn)動(dòng)態(tài)日歷功能第4章 JSP與Servlet 實(shí)例30 使用Servlet實(shí)現(xiàn)數(shù)據(jù)庫(kù)添加、刪除和修改 實(shí)例31 使用Servlet實(shí)現(xiàn)數(shù)據(jù)庫(kù)分頁(yè)顯示 實(shí)例32 使用Servlet實(shí)現(xiàn)簡(jiǎn)單購(gòu)物車(chē) 實(shí)例33 使用Servlet動(dòng)態(tài)生成圖片 實(shí)例34 使用Servlet調(diào)用JavaBean實(shí)現(xiàn)猜數(shù)字游戲 實(shí)例35 使用JSP+Servlet+JavaaBean開(kāi)發(fā)用戶(hù)登錄示例 實(shí)例36 使用JSP+Servlet+JavaBean開(kāi)發(fā)簡(jiǎn)單通訊錄第5章 實(shí)現(xiàn)基本Ajax技術(shù) 實(shí)例37 “你好,Aiax”實(shí)例 實(shí)例38 在客戶(hù)端解析普通字符串實(shí)例 實(shí)例39 在客戶(hù)端解析XML格式字符串 實(shí)例40 在客戶(hù)端發(fā)送無(wú)參數(shù)請(qǐng)求 實(shí)例41 在客戶(hù)端發(fā)送有參數(shù)請(qǐng)求 實(shí)例42 在客戶(hù)端以表格形式顯示數(shù)據(jù) 實(shí)例43 在客戶(hù)端以指定CSS樣式顯示數(shù)據(jù) 實(shí)例44 用戶(hù)登錄實(shí)例 實(shí)例45 用戶(hù)注冊(cè)實(shí)例 實(shí)例46 頁(yè)面自動(dòng)刷新功能第6章 實(shí)現(xiàn)高級(jí)Ajax技術(shù) 實(shí)例47 Web頁(yè)面局部動(dòng)態(tài)更新 實(shí)例48 讀取響應(yīng)首部 實(shí)例49 動(dòng)態(tài)加載下拉列表框 實(shí)例50 實(shí)現(xiàn)進(jìn)度條 實(shí)例51 創(chuàng)建工具提示 實(shí)例52 訪問(wèn)Web服務(wù) 實(shí)例53 實(shí)現(xiàn)自動(dòng)完成功能 實(shí)例54 實(shí)現(xiàn)級(jí)聯(lián)菜單 實(shí)例55 實(shí)現(xiàn)樹(shù)狀菜單 實(shí)例56 實(shí)現(xiàn)上傳文件進(jìn)度條第7章 Aiax數(shù)據(jù)庫(kù)操作 實(shí)例57 顯示數(shù)據(jù)庫(kù)系統(tǒng)信息 實(shí)例58 實(shí)現(xiàn)數(shù)據(jù)庫(kù)添加、修改和刪除操作 實(shí)例59 實(shí)現(xiàn)動(dòng)態(tài)樹(shù)狀列表 實(shí)例60 數(shù)據(jù)動(dòng)態(tài)查詢(xún)與排序 實(shí)例61 以多種指定CSS樣式顯示數(shù)據(jù) 實(shí)例62 局部動(dòng)態(tài)更新數(shù)據(jù)庫(kù)數(shù)據(jù) 實(shí)例63 數(shù)據(jù)分頁(yè)顯示第8章 Aiax時(shí)尚技術(shù) 實(shí)例64 根據(jù)郵編自動(dòng)完成地址信息 實(shí)例65 實(shí)現(xiàn)域名查詢(xún) 實(shí)例66 實(shí)現(xiàn)搜索提示 實(shí)例67 根據(jù)省代碼列出城市信息 實(shí)例68 自動(dòng)保存草稿 實(shí)例69 切換標(biāo)簽頁(yè) 實(shí)例70 信息排序 實(shí)例71 實(shí)時(shí)更新的股價(jià) 實(shí)例72 條件設(shè)置向?qū)У?章 Aiax框架的使用 實(shí)例73 Prototype框架實(shí)現(xiàn)網(wǎng)站問(wèn)候 實(shí)例74 Prototype框架實(shí)現(xiàn)用戶(hù)登錄驗(yàn)證 實(shí)例75 DWR框架實(shí)現(xiàn)用戶(hù)注冊(cè) 實(shí)例76 DWR框架實(shí)現(xiàn)呼叫程序 實(shí)例77 Buffalo框架實(shí)現(xiàn)簡(jiǎn)單購(gòu)物車(chē) 實(shí)例78 Buffalo框架實(shí)現(xiàn)計(jì)算器 實(shí)例79 Doio框架實(shí)現(xiàn)異步調(diào)用 實(shí)例80 Doio框架實(shí)現(xiàn)讀取RSS新聞 實(shí)例81 MooTools框架實(shí)現(xiàn)事件處理 實(shí)例82 MooTools框架實(shí)現(xiàn)邊欄平滑菜單第10章 綜合實(shí)例——OA系統(tǒng)(匯智科技) 實(shí)例83 實(shí)現(xiàn)OA需求分析和系統(tǒng)設(shè)計(jì) 實(shí)例84 實(shí)現(xiàn)數(shù)據(jù)庫(kù)設(shè)計(jì) 實(shí)例85 實(shí)現(xiàn)OA系統(tǒng)通用模塊 實(shí)例86 實(shí)現(xiàn)用戶(hù)注冊(cè)和登錄子模塊 實(shí)例87 實(shí)現(xiàn)主頁(yè)面框架 實(shí)例88 實(shí)現(xiàn)工作計(jì)劃模塊 實(shí)例89 實(shí)現(xiàn)工作任務(wù)模塊 實(shí)例90 實(shí)現(xiàn)日程安排模塊 實(shí)例91 實(shí)現(xiàn)工作日志模塊 實(shí)例92 實(shí)現(xiàn)個(gè)人設(shè)置模塊 實(shí)例93 實(shí)現(xiàn)請(qǐng)假管理模塊 實(shí)例94 實(shí)現(xiàn)出差管理模塊 實(shí)例95 實(shí)現(xiàn)加班管理模塊 實(shí)例96 實(shí)現(xiàn)考勤管理模塊
章節(jié)摘錄
JSP (Java Server Pages)是由Sun Microsystems公司倡導(dǎo)、許多公司參與并共同建立的一種動(dòng)態(tài)網(wǎng)頁(yè)技術(shù)標(biāo)準(zhǔn)。JSP技術(shù)自誕生到現(xiàn)在,已經(jīng)成為流行技術(shù)之一,尤其是在開(kāi)發(fā)電子商務(wù)類(lèi)的網(wǎng)站方面。JSP以其安全性高、支持多線程、跨平臺(tái)等特性占領(lǐng)了Web開(kāi)發(fā)的中、高層領(lǐng)域。針對(duì)此種情況,結(jié)合讀者長(zhǎng)期的JSP開(kāi)發(fā)經(jīng)驗(yàn),本章篩選出JSP技術(shù)的常用的,基本的實(shí)例,作為讀者入門(mén)的實(shí)例?! ?shí)例1 JSP測(cè)試頁(yè)面 一個(gè)JSP頁(yè)面由HTML代碼、嵌入的Java腳本程序和JSP指令組成, 有時(shí)可能是純粹的HTML代碼或Java代碼。本實(shí)例只是實(shí)現(xiàn)一個(gè)測(cè)試頁(yè)面,用來(lái)顯示一些簡(jiǎn)單的信息。這實(shí)現(xiàn)起來(lái)非常簡(jiǎn)單,通過(guò)本實(shí)例主要讓讀者了解JSP文件的創(chuàng)建與在Tomcat中的部署。 操作要點(diǎn) 了解JSP文檔結(jié)構(gòu) 掌握在文檔中嵌入JSP代碼的方式 在JSP中初步使用Java提供的類(lèi) 操作步驟 ?。?)JSP頁(yè)面的開(kāi)發(fā)工具雖然有很多,但是對(duì)于初學(xué)者來(lái)說(shuō),這是建議使用記事本來(lái)編輯文件上,只有這樣,當(dāng)讀者一行行地輸入代碼的同時(shí),知識(shí)也一點(diǎn)點(diǎn)地嵌入到讀者的腦海里。打開(kāi)記事本,創(chuàng)建test.jsp文件,在第一行輸入如下代碼。
編輯推薦
JSP+Ajax開(kāi)發(fā)模式是Web 2.0開(kāi)發(fā)大潮中比較流行的一種模式本書(shū)精選JSP+Ajax開(kāi)發(fā)中常用的經(jīng)典實(shí)例。內(nèi)容的安排由淺入深,初級(jí)讀者可以循序漸進(jìn)進(jìn)行學(xué)習(xí),逐步掌握J(rèn)SP+Ajax技術(shù);更高水平的讀者,也可以在Web開(kāi)發(fā)中有針對(duì)性地查閱此書(shū)。
圖書(shū)封面
圖書(shū)標(biāo)簽Tags
無(wú)
評(píng)論、評(píng)分、閱讀與下載
JSP+Ajax網(wǎng)站開(kāi)發(fā)典型實(shí)例 PDF格式下載
250萬(wàn)本中文圖書(shū)簡(jiǎn)介、評(píng)論、評(píng)分,PDF格式免費(fèi)下載。 第一圖書(shū)網(wǎng) 手機(jī)版